Have you ever thought of why it's important to try and improve yourself?
Here is what I think;
There is an ever-present human tendency towards envy and resentment. We all have it in us and these things can blow out of proportion if we don't try to have them in check. This is why I see Self-improvement as a heroic endeavour. Making effort to improve ourselves can help you to make sure that you won't let envy or resentment take over your being.
Well, those who take the whole 'I love myself the way I am' narrative and push it to an extreme are usually the type that won't make effort to improve anything about themselves and when they see that the rest of the world is moving forward while they are stuck in the same place for a couple of years, they will start to get envious and resentful.
Add irresponsibility to that and you will have someone who blames others for their stagnancy... A complete mess.
People like that are always out to cause mayhem and it wouldn't take a lot of provocation for them to start being envious of those who have made significant improvements in their own life. It's a bad road to go down because these sorts of negative emotions will crush someone like that and make them toxic to be around.
I assume you wouldn't want to be that person. You also wouldn't want to be around people who envy your success. This is why you have to work on improving yourself in all aspects of your life. Don't be too comfortable with the current life you are living. Also, don't allow those around you to be too comfortable with the baggage of bad habits they have. If they don't improve themselves over a long period, chances are; they will become envious of your success.
Sure, no man is an island. Just make sure you are around people who strive to be better in all aspects of their life. It goes without saying that you can't afford to ignore your own baggage of bad habits. Clean them up and be a better you.
